> > Furthermore, when the generator processes subsequent references to the
> > same unresolved weak kfunc, it copies the imm and off fields from
> > the first occurrence but skips the src_reg field, meaning subsequent
> > calls also retain the poisonous BPF_PSEUDO_KFUNC_CALL flag.
> >
> > This patch fixes the issue by explicitly clearing src_reg for both the
> > initial occurrence and all subsequent occurrences of unresolved weak
> > kfuncs, converting them into standard invalid helper calls that the
> > verifier's dead-code eliminator can safely recognize and discard.
